Choice Hotels to acquire Radisson Hotel Group Americas
Choice Hotels International, Inc. will acquire Radisson Hotel Group Americas for approximately $675 million.
Radisson operates nine hotel brands in the Americas.
The added 624 hotels with over 68,000 rooms expand Choice Hotels’ presence in the upscale and core upper-midscale hospitality segments, particularly in the West Coast and Midwest.
Patrick Pacious, President and Chief Executive Officer of Choice Hotels, said, “Choice has a well-established history of smart acquisitions in new segments. This transaction brings together two highly complementary businesses.”
Choice Hotels will acquire the franchise business, operations and intellectual property of Radisson Hotels in the US, Canada, Latin America and the Caribbean, inclusive of the real estate value of three owned assets.
The acquisition will be funded with cash on hand and revolver borrowings.
It includes 10 Radisson Blu hotels, 130 Radisson hotels, 9 Radisson Individuals, 1 Park Plaza hotel, 4 Radisson RED hotels, 453 Country Inn & Suites by Radisson and 17 Park Inn by Radisson hotels, as well as the Radisson Inn & Suites and Radisson Collection brands.
Choice Hotels will independently own and control the brands in the Americas and will work with the Radisson Hotel Group to drive success of the brands.
The transaction was unanimously approved by Choice Hotels’ Board of Directors and is expected to close in the second half of 2022.
